Installing a new battery using the replacement key for honda

Whether you have lost your key or need to replace a dead battery, changing the battery on your Honda key is a quick and simple procedure. This can save you time and money. This guide will guide you through the process.

The first step is to open the fob. To get the key out you'll need a flat-head screwdriver. If you aren't sure how to open the fob on your Honda model, refer to the manual.

Once you have the key out it is time to test the buttons. The key fob may be programmed to lock and unlock doors, but it is important to make sure that they are working correctly. You can also unlock the doors to start the engine.

The next step is to remove the key made of metal from the fob. This may be done using a jeweler's screwdriver. It's a good idea to have a spare key at hand if you're replacing the battery.

Now, you'll need add the new battery. Most Honda models use a flat, circular 3-volt battery. These batteries can be found at your local hardware store or online at AutoZone.

It is vital to make sure that the battery is installed correctly. You'll need to ensure that the positive and negative indications are facing upwards. Also, make sure that the rubber film isn't in contact with the buttons.
